Dietary Tips on How to Get Pregnant

Before asking the experts how to get pregnant, perhaps it is best that you do everything you can first to boost your chances of conceiving. For instance, if there are recommended foods to increase fertility, then there’s surely nothing wrong in including them in your diet. The same goes for the foods which decrease your chances of pregnancy. If they are not helpful, might as well turn your back against them – or at least until you have successfully delivered a healthy baby.

Basically, everything considered as “unhealthy” is not supposed to be included in your daily meals. Foods which have preservatives and other chemicals like artificial colorings and sweeteners must be avoided as they affect your blood sugar levels as well as your hormones. When these things are affected, your fertility rate gets affected too.

Remember that there are hormones at work in producing healthy eggs for fertilization. When these biological substances are affected, their jobs may get affected too. For one, you may fail to produce good eggs that have the potential to create healthy embryos.

You should also limit your intake of refined carbohydrates like white rice, white bread, and pasta. They have gone through processes which stripped them off vital nutrients like B vitamins and iron. Both nutrients are highly important in giving a valuable nutrient base to a potential fetus. If you like bread, go for whole wheat instead. They are not only much healthier but can also make you feel full faster.

If you have polycystic ovary syndrome or PCOS, going for whole grains is especially important because they help in taming the hormonal imbalance which causes the insulin levels to increase. Women suffering from PCOS have trouble getting pregnant because the syndrome may lead to irregular ovulation. Logically, the more erratic your ovulation is, the harder it is to get pregnant.

If you are a coffee lover or simply a caffeine junkie, you should start cutting back on the substance too. Caffeine has the capacity to constrict the blood vessels. In the perspective of conception, this is bad because it can lessen the blood flow in the uterus and hinder the eggs from attaching to the uterine wall.

Now, as protein is deemed to be very important for conception, it may lead you to conclude that it’s OK to gobble up on meats since they are the richest source of the nutrient. Well, you are mistaken. Too much meat is bad for you and the baby. For one, it may increase the ammonia levels in your body, which in turn may hinder the implantation of the egg in your uterus. The best way to go is eat meat in moderation and find other non-meat sources of protein such as dairy products.

These are just some of the dietary tips that you ought to follow if you truly wish to learn how to get pregnant. Although they are not the sole key to conceiving, they can surely help a lot in increasing your chances of becoming a mom soon.
